ABSTRACT:
An inner- or outer-rotor type three-phase permanent magnet stepping motor constituted by a stator having circumferentially equidistantly arranged three magnetic poles each having small teeth equal in number and in pitch, and a rotor rotatably arranged along the circumference of the stator and constituted by a cylindrical permanent magnet magnetized to provide circumferentially alternately arranged pairs of north and south poles, the number of the pairs being selected to Zm under the condition that Zm satisfies Zm=3n-1 or Zm =3n+1 (n being a natural number not smaller than 1). Alternatively, the rotor is constituted by a ring-like permanent magnet magnetized so as to form two magnetic poles in the axial direction thereof and a pair of gear-like magnetic bodies each having Zr teeth on its circumference are arranged respectively on the axially opposite ends of the ring-like permanent magnet. The respective teeth arrangements of the gear-like magnetic bodies are circumferentially shifted by 1/2 teeth pitch, under the condition that the number Zr of the teeth satisfies Zr=3n-1 or Zr-3n+1. Further, the small teeth of the stator are circumferentially arranged substantially in the same pitch as that of the poles or teeth of the rotor so that static and dynamic torque of the stepping motor including cogging torque are increased.
